Social Media & Marketing Manager
POSITION:
We’re looking for an experienced, passionate and versatile Marketing/Social Media Manager to support our local grassroots and digital marketing efforts in the areas in and around: Short Hills, Livingston and Montclair.
The ideal candidate has experience in developing and executing marketing campaigns, while managing and inspiring a team to follow-through on those strategies. They are equally proficient in day-to-day marketing activities and long-term strategizing. They also strive under tight deadlines to meet the company's changing needs. OBJECTIVES: • The primary objective of this role is to drive local leads into the Rumble Boxing studios• Identify target audiences in the region and develop grassroots campaigns in order to inform the
community about Rumble Boxing and generate quality leads
• Be on hand to oversee daily studio operations if necessary
• Develop and execute monthly marketing plans for the region, leveraging team members from all
three Rumble Boxing locations
• Coordinate with studio managers
• Develop and execute a plan for evaluating grassroots marketing campaigns in order to understand
the factors affecting conversion rate
• Coordinate directly with the corporate marketing office to ensure alignment with all corporate
marketing campaigns
• Work with corporate marketing vendors to target high-quality leads REQUIREMENTS: • 2+ years of professional marketing experience
• Strong managerial skill set with the ability to set goals, and forecast the resources required to accomplish the goals
• Must have excellent communication and strong interpersonal skills in person and over the phone
• Must have prior sales experience
• Must be willing to attend and oversee grassroots marketing events, and have the ability to set up a
portable table and aluminum-frame canopy
• Must be proficient in content creation and be willing to post content daily on Instagram, TikTok,
Facebook, etc.
• Excellent written, grammar and verbal communication skills
• Must be solution-based and results oriented, competitive spirit
• Must be proficient in public speaking
• Any other duties as assigned
• Bachelors degree in marketing (or related discipline) PREFERRED SKILLS: • Proficiency in productivity software such as Powerpoint, Excel, and Word
• Experience with Digital Stack
• Experience with ClubReady
COMPENSATION & PERKS:
• Complimentary fitness membership while employed• Employee retail discounts *This is a part-time position with the opportunity to turn full-time based on performance and if company goals are met/exceeded.
